Instructor - Dentistry teaches courses in the discipline area of dentistry. Develops and designs curriculum plans to foster student learning, stimulate class discussions, and ensures student engagement. Being an Instructor - Dentistry provides tutoring and academic counseling to students, maintains classes related records, and assesses student coursework. Collaborates and supports colleagues regarding research interests and co-curricular activities. Additionally, Instructor - Dentistry typically reports to a department head. Has a Master's degree or is a PhD candidate in the applicable field. Has experience and is qualified to teach at undergraduate level and possesses the qualifications to participate in research. Alpine Dentistry is hiring a FT Office Manager responsible for providing amazing customer service, checking patients in/out, appointment scheduling, referral management, assisting with insurance claims and clerical duties. Position offers 100% paid health insurance, PTO and holidays. Office hours are Tuesday – Friday, 8am – 4pm. We look forward to hearing from you!
Office Manager Duties
Run daily employee meeting
Return calls and schedule accordingly
Open mail and sort bills for bookkeeper
Check in and walk out patients
Create treatment plans for patients
Discuss financial agreements/plans
Scan referral slips and help patient schedule with the other office
Check in lab cases
Sending prescriptions when needed to pharmacies
Order office supplies
Keep computers running smoothly/operating systems/updates
Human Resource paperwork
Calling A/R list every month to check on payments
Importing photos for patients charts and creating PowerPoint's
Closing reports for end of day (and end of month) in eagle soft
Submit Insurance claims
Daily deposit taken to Bank
